UNDP has been supporting the development efforts of Kazakhstan since independence, with major focus on all pillars of sustainable development: social, economic and environmental. Its work is aimed at strengthening human development for all so that no one is left behind. The UNDP CO jointly with the Government institutions and other stakeholders implements several strategic initiatives in various sectors ranging from preserving biodiversity to supporting people with disabilities. Governance area is an integral part of the UNDP CO programme, which primarily focuses on building effective, efficient, transparent and accountable institutions, free of corruption. Governance programme consists of several strategic initiatives that support Kazakhstan modernization efforts with focus on priority reform areas stretching from Civil Service Reform and Rule of Law to Prevention of Violent Extremism and addressing the needs of most vulnerable groups of population. The Governance programme activities are implemented in close partnership and collaboration with the Government of Kazakhstan on national and subnational levels, expert community, academia and civil society organizations.
